Getting home from tonight's performance, and am in total disagreement with the previous posters. I thought the evening for the most part was a total bore, and at two and half hours it ran WAY too long. By the last half hour or so I just kept hoping for it to end.
I'll give John that he has boundless energy, but it was never focused. He basically goes through his theater credits and highlights of his movie career, but it felt tedious and in the same turns self-congratulatory and complaint-riddled about how hard it's all been.
I don't know if he would consider it, but I think it would work so much better as a 90 or 100 minute one act. It just seemed like so much could be trimmed...
I will concede that there were those who were having a great time tonight, and if there's an audience for this show fine. I guess it's just not for me.
